Join Us for the March for Climate, Jobs and Justice on April 29 in Ithaca

PLEASE JOIN US! The Tompkins County Workers’ Center is cosponsoring a local March for Climate, Jobs and Justice to coincide with the national march in Washington DC this Saturday April 29. We are hoping for at least 1,000 people from across the region to participate in a visible show of concern for the rapid deterioration of the planet. Hundreds of similar marches are planned in cities across the country to protest the reversal of climate protections by the Trump administration. Our plan is to gather at 11:30 at the Bernie Milton Pavilion on The Commons in Ithaca for a rally and satirical skit by a stiltwalking theater troupe. Then we’ll follow the Fall Creek Brass Band and march down to the Space @ GreenStar where we’ll be hosting a second rally followed by music, food, workshops and a chance to check out local organizations working to protect our climate and shared future.
